    MEMORANDUM OPINION
    Before Chief Justice Wright, Justice Evans, and Justice Brown
    Opinion by Chief Justice Wright
    By order dated August 10, 2018, the Court granted the parties’ motion to abate the appeal
    to allow the trial court to sign an amended decree of divorce pursuant to their agreement. On
    October 10, 2018, the Court received a supplemental clerk’s record containing the Amended Final
    Decree of Divorce. By order dated October 18, 2018 the Court reinstated the appeal and instructed
    appellant to file, by October 29, 2018, either a motion to dismiss the appeal or a letter explaining
    why we should not dismiss the appeal as moot. We cautioned appellant that failure to comply may
    result in dismissal of the appeal without further notice. As of today’s date, appellant has not
    responded. Accordingly, we dismiss the appeal as moot. See Nat’l Collegiate Athletic Ass’n v.
    Jones, 
    1 S.W.3d 83
    , 86 (Tex. 1999) (case becomes moot and court loses jurisdiction if controversy
    between parties ceases to exist); TEX. R. APP. P. 42.3(a).
